Epson announces consumer range expansion

The OEM’s latest additions to its consumer range are described as “contemporary, space-saving inkjet printers with versatile functionality.”

Epson has announced the latest additions to its lineup of inkjet printers for the home – the XP-6100/6105/7100 and ET-2710/2711 – which are said to feature “a sleek and compact aesthetic.”

The Expression Premium XP-6100 series and XP-7100 are described by the OEM as “great options for households looking for a stylish and highly functional printer.” The compact all-in-ones are capable of producing both “high-quality photos and sharp documents”, while also being economical with double-sided printing and individual inks.

Wireless printing and scanning is also on offer – laptops can benefit from Wi-Fi and Wi-Fi Direct, while smart phones and tablets can also utilise the compatible free Epson apps – iPrint and Creative Print. A first for the Expression Premium range, the XP-7100 additionally offers a double-sided Automatic Document Feeder for multi-page scanning and copying.

Epson’s latest cartridge-free EcoTank printers, ET-2710 and ET-2711, are the first entry level models to incorporate the re-engineered design with front facing ink tanks. The OEM adds that this design offers “improved usability and a more compact footprint. Typical of the EcoTank range, these printers will minimise refills and reduce ink costs by 90% on average, printing up to 4,500 pages in black and 7,500 in colour from just one set of high-yield ink bottles. It’s also easy to print from mobiles and tablets with flexible connectivity solutions including Wi-Fi, Wi-Fi Direct and compatible free Epson apps – iPrint and Creative Print.”

The XP-6100, XP-6105 and XP-7100 are available from October 2018, whilst the ET-2710 and ET-2711 are available from September 2018.
